Marc Davis

Marc Davis grew up at New Life Church in Jenkintown, Pennsylvania, in the years when Serge (formerly World Harvest Mission) was being launched. During those years, he saw people being transformed by the gospel of grace, and that same grace got hold of him, too. He completed an M.Div. from Westminster Seminary in 1997, and is an ordained minister in the Presbyterian Church in America and served on the pastoral staff at New Life Church (now Glenside) for 12 years. Marc joined Serge’s Renewal team in 2019 as Global Learning Program Leader. In that role, he is excited to see missionaries, pastors, and others involved in ministry empowered by the gospel to live lives of great freedom in dependence on Jesus for everything. Eric Brauer serves as a Renewal Specialist at Serge, primarily focused on mentoring church leaders, fostering international renewal with Serge teams overseas, and coaching Serge workers mentoring national church planters. Before this, he and his wife Karen spent over 30 years serving overseas with Serge, initially in the Republic of Ireland coaching and mentoring Irish church leaders and then in Germany/Austria overseeing Serge’s teams and coaching national church planters throughout Central Europe. Eric and Karen were first introduced to Serge when they went through the Sonship course at New Life Church while Eric was a student at Westminster Theological Seminary in Philadelphia. What is Sonship?

It was while doing cross-cultural, team-oriented ministry that Serge missionaries discovered how challenging it is to be grounded in a biblical identity as sons and daughters of God—even in the midst of missional work. So, Serge leaders developed the Sonship Curriculum to equip missionaries to live out the gospel in their daily lives and nurture a new boldness to share the love of Christ with others.

Over the years, we have taken the grace-based principles of Sonship and expanded it into various formats, including our one-on-one mentoring program, Mentored Sonship, and for multiple cultural contexts, religious backgrounds, and specific life applications.
